Toshiba America Medical Systems Inc. has enhanced its Vantage Titan Magnetic Resonance product line with new features that improve workflow, image quality and patient comfort.
"These new technologies make MR exams more comfortable for patients and increase workflow for our customers," said Beverly Plost, director, MR Business Unit, Toshiba.
The company's enhancements to the Vantage Titan product line include:
- --- Flexible Coils: The high-density, 16ch Flex Speeder coils conform closer to the patient’s anatomy, improving signal-to-noise ratio for enhanced image quality, executives claim. The light-weight coils are available in medium and large sizes and are designed for general orthopedic and body imaging.
- --- 3T 32ch Head Speeder Coil: The 32ch Head Speeder coil improves image quality for high-end neuro applications in 3T imaging, such as fMRI and diffusion tensor imaging, with high signal-to-noise ratio and high spatial and temporal resolution.
- --- Rapid Transport System (RTS): The light-weight and easy-to-maneuver RTS is designed to transport patients to the MRI suite for scanning without the need for repositioning, improving workflow and throughput. The RTS docks over the MR system’s couch so the patient stays on one table during the entire imaging process.
